Abstract

This paper studies the stability properties of singularly perturbed switched systems with time delay and impulsive effects. Such systems are assumed to consist of both unstable and stable subsystems. By using the multiple Lyapunov functions technique and the dwell time approach, some stability criteria are established. Our results show that impulses do contribute in order to obtain stability properties even when the system consists of only unstable subsystems. Numerical examples are presented to verify our theoretical results.
